Back to School: 1.85m Students Begin New Academic Year in Shanghai

Today marked the start of the new school year for about 1.85 million elementary and secondary students in Shanghai.

The city has unveiled 40 newly established primary and secondary school campuses for the 2026 academic year, creating nearly 9,500 additional seats for local children.

More than 40,000 police officers and auxiliary staff were deployed throughout the city, ensuring that traffic flowed smoothly in school zones.

All schools in Shanghai are now required to ensure that every student engages in a minimum of two hours of physical activity each day.

This includes physical education lessons, extended breaks, extracurricular activities, sports clubs, and competitive events.

As part of the city's initiative to promote youth health, there is a focused effort on monitoring essential health indicators: vision, weight, spinal health and oral hygiene.
